Morse Alpha is a small school with reputation for robust coastal and offshore sail training, specializing in mid and upper-level ASA classes.

Morse Alpha started in 2014 as an independent sailing school and is the culmination of over 30 years in the marine industry, working aboard educational tall ships, tugboats, commercial fishing boats, and an extensive variety of sailboats and sailing yachts. Equally important is our background in experiential education programs such as Sea Education Association, NOLS, and Outward Bound, which have greatly influenced our teaching philosophy. Our diverse experiences offer a unique perspective and a strong foundation in education. We’re not just sailors making a living doing what we love; we are dedicated educators who love to sail.

Our goal is not just to help you pass a test quickly for certification—but rather on equipping you with the skills that lead to competence, followed by confidence. All our courses are 100% live aboard. Our training vessel is Rocinante, a Norseman 447, designed by Bob Perry. Whether you plan to sail your own boat or charter, our mission is to ensure you’re fully prepared for the adventure. Every crew member gains a solid foundation in sailing, weather, navigation etc, as well as real-life leadership and communication skills – plus a feeling that they all got there together. This is real world, hands-on 24/7, coastal and offshore sailing education during which you will learn to manage all aspects of running the boat.

Each expedition is led by a USCG-licensed captain and mate. We take a maximum of five students for each class. That means effective and individualized instruction to meet you at your level and focus on what you need most. Our class offerings run from 6-15 days and provide an intensive and rewarding experience for every student.
